Entry instructions: The essay & artwork ( 8 ½ x 11 drawing, or other Art medium), must be your own work – not copied and/or pasted. The essay and artwork should be thoroughly researched. Essays must be appropriately cited using 3 separate resources (Wikipedia can not be your primary source), a minimum of 500 words with a maximum of 700 words using MLA format, applicant’s name should be on the cover sheet only.
The Queen’s judging will be as follows: 75%: Essay, based on the Celtic values of scholarship, research, and fine writing, 15%: Service to the Krewe/Community Service, and 10%: Queen’s Application Question.
The Krewe of Erin Royal Court Committee Application judges will include teachers and/or professors, prior Queens, and other professionals/dignitaries.
Court notification, along with notice of Awards, will occur post judging on Saturday January 10, 2026, by Queen's Committee.
